利用C#开发ONVIF客户端和集成RTSP播放功能
利用C#开发ONVIF客户端和集成RTSP播放功能 C#开发ONVIF客户端与RTSP播放库指南 1. ONVIF客户端开发 ONVIF(开放型网络视频接口论坛)协议是实现不同品牌网络视频设备互操作性的国际标准。以下是使用C#开发ONVIF客户端的关键方案: 推荐开源库:XiaoFeng.Onvif 这是一个基于.NET平台的优秀开源库&#...
Azure 云服务与 C# 集成浅谈
随着云计算技术的快速发展,越来越多的企业开始将业务迁移到云端。Azure 作为微软提供的云服务平台,提供了丰富的服务和工具,支持多种编程语言,其中 C# 是最常用的语言之一。本文将从基础概念入手,逐步深入探讨 Azure 云服务与 C# 的集成方法,并通过代码示例说明常见问题及其解决方法。 1. 基础概念 Azu...
C# 一分钟浅谈:自动化部署与持续集成
在现代软件开发中,自动化部署和持续集成(Continuous Integration, CI)已经成为提高开发效率、减少错误、加快产品迭代速度的重要手段。本文将从基础概念出发,逐步深入探讨自动化部署与持续集成在C#项目中的应用,包括常见的问题、易错点以及如何避免这些问题。 1. 基础概念 1.1 持续集成(CI&...
C# 一分钟浅谈:集成测试与系统测试
在软件开发过程中,测试是确保产品质量的重要环节。集成测试和系统测试作为测试流程中的两个关键阶段,对于发现并修复缺陷、提高软件可靠性具有重要作用。本文将从概念入手,逐步深入探讨这两个测试阶段的常见问题、易错点及如何避免,并通过代码案例进行说明。 一、集成测试与系统测试的概念 1. 集成测试 定义:集成测试(Inte...
C#开源实用的工具类库,集成超过1000多种扩展方法
前言 今天大姚给大家分享一个C#开源(MIT License)、免费、实用且强大的工具类库,集成超过1000多种扩展方法增强 .NET Framework 和 .NET Core的使用效率:Z.ExtensionMethods。 直接项目引入类库使用 在你的对应项目中NuGet包管理器中搜索:Z.ExtensionMethods安装即可使用。 支持.N...
【C#】C# 开发环境配置(Rider 一个.NET 跨平台集成开发环境)
编辑目录Rider IDE 概述: Rider IDE 官方下载链接:.NET 官方下载链接:Hello World !测试环境:1.新建一个解决方案:2.配置解决方案类型:3.新建一个Project:4.编写Hello World 层序:Rider IDE 概述: 对,没错又是我,这次带来的是.NET(C#)开发环境 Ride.....
C# Linq语言集成查询
一、前言Lambda表达式实际上是一个匿名函数,=>即为Lambda表达式的运算符,Lambda表达式可以取代一些繁琐的遍历过程,大大减少代码量,使得代码更加的优美、简洁,更有可观性。1. where查询一、前言 Lambda表达式实际上是一个匿名函数,=>即为Lambda表达式的运算符,Lambda表达式可以取代一些繁琐的遍历过程,大大减少代码量,使得代码更加的优美、简洁,更有可观....
推荐一个不到2MB的C#开发工具箱,集成了上千个常用操作类
今天给大家推荐一个C#开发工具箱,涵盖了所有常用操作类,体积小、功能强大。项目简介C# 开发工具箱。大都是静态类,加密解密,反射操作,权重随机筛选算法,分布式短id,表达式树,linq扩展,文件压缩,多线程下载和FTP客户端,硬件信息,字符串扩展方法,日期时间扩展操作,中国农历,大文件拷贝,图像裁剪,验证码,断点续传,集合扩展、Excel导出等常用封装。诸多功能集一身,代码量不到2MB!技术架构....
【优化】C#小程序集成实现python定时段批量下载电子邮箱附件的bug排除
目录1、测试问题与现象2、排查和发现3、bug危害和改正措施继上一篇长文(python实现电子邮件附件指定时间段,批量下载以及C#小程序集成实现_nanke_yh的博客-CSDN博客https://blog.csdn.net/nanke_yh/article/details/120818221)中所实现的程序之后,进行了相关的应用和测试,发现了一些bug,这些bug导致的问题比较严重,在这里进行....
python实现电子邮件附件指定时间段,批量下载以及C#小程序集成实现(二)
4.3 C#内部代码实现 根据需求设计出界面后,则需要代码实现内部相关的功能。1、保存路径中“选择路径”效果如下:因为保存路径需要输入绝对路径,那么路径太长的时候,手动输入还是比较麻烦,直接点击按钮“选择路径”,会弹出窗口,然后自己选择本机中对应的路径文件夹,然后该路径同时显示在textbox中。实现代码(参考[5]): /// <s...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。